Skylight Repair in Santa Rosa, CA
Skylight repair services address issues related to damaged or malfunctioning skylights that may lead to leaks, drafts, or reduced natural light. These projects typically involve fixing leaks, replacing broken glass or seals, and repairing or replacing damaged framing components. Homeowners often seek skylight repairs to restore the integrity of their roof openings, prevent water intrusion, and improve energy efficiency. Before requesting repairs, property owners should understand the type of skylight installed, the extent of the damage, and any previous issues that may influence the scope of work.
It is important for property owners to assess whether their skylight is a fixed, vented, or tubular model, as different types may require specific repair techniques. Additionally, understanding the age of the skylight and any prior repairs can help determine the best course of action. Clear communication about the visible signs of damage, such as condensation, water stains, or cracked glass, can assist in accurately diagnosing the problem. Proper evaluation ensures that repairs address the root cause and help maintain the skylight’s functionality and longevity.

Common Skylight Repair Jobs
Skylight Glass Replacement - broken or cracked glass can be repaired or replaced to restore natural light.
Leaking Skylight Repairs - addressing leaks to prevent water damage and improve roof integrity.
Skylight Seal Repair - worn or damaged seals are replaced to prevent drafts and water intrusion.
Skylight Flashing Repair - damaged or corroded flashing is fixed to ensure a weather-tight seal.
Skylight Vent Repair - malfunctioning vents are repaired to improve ventilation and airflow.
Skylight Leak Prevention - inspections and repairs help prevent future leaks and maintain roof durability.
Skylight Repair Questions
What signs indicate a skylight needs repair? Common signs include leaks, condensation, drafts, or visible damage to the skylight frame or glass.
Can damaged skylights be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many issues such as leaks or cracks can often be fixed without full replacement.
What types of skylight problems are most common? Leaks, broken glass, and issues with the flashing or seals are typical problems encountered.
How does weather affect skylight repairs? Severe weather can cause additional damage or delays, but repairs can be performed once conditions improve.
